STAMFORD, Conn. – August 22, 2024 – NBC Sports’ motorsports coverage this weekend will be dominated by the penultimate NASCAR Cup Series regular-season race at the legendary Daytona International Speedway on NBC and Peacock on Saturday, INDYCAR at Portland International Raceway on USA Network and Peacock on Sunday, and Pro Motocross from Ironman Raceway exclusively on Peacock on Saturday.

NASCAR: CUP SERIES COKE ZERO SUGAR 400 and XFINITY SERIES WAWA 250 with COCA-COLA power

Daytona International Speedway in Daytona Beach, Florida, hosts the NASCAR Cup Series Coke Zero Sugar 400 on NBC this Saturday at 7:30 p.m. ET. A 30-minute Countdown to green Live coverage of the race continues on NBC on Saturday at 7:00 p.m. ET.

With only two races left in the regular season and 16 playoff spots at stake, Tyler Reddick (814 points) jumped to first place in the Cup Series points standings after his win at Michigan last week. Chase Elliott (-10), Denny Hamlin (-28), Kyle Larson (-32) and Ryan Blaney (-82) round out the top 5. Top 10 finishers 2023 Bubba Wallace and two-time series champion Kyle Busch are on the brink of the playoff race.

INDYCAR: BITNILE.COM GRAND PRIX OF PORTLAND

The NTT INDYCAR SERIES heads to Portland, Oregon, this Sunday at 3:30 p.m. ET from Portland International Raceway for the BitNile.com Grand Prix of Portland on USA Network and Peacock. Pre-race coverage begins at 3 p.m. ET on USA Network and Peacock.

Live coverage of qualifying and practice sessions from the track tomorrow and Saturday will be streamed exclusively on Peacock. For more information on Peacock’s comprehensive streaming coverage of the 2024 INDYCAR season and to sign up, click here Here.

With only four races left, the reigning INDYCAR champion Alex Palou (443 points) continues to lead the 2024 points table, followed by Colton Herta (-59), Scott Dixon (-65), Willpower (-66) and Scott McLaughlin (-73). Palou has won this race in two of the last three years (2023, 2021).

The NBC Sports INDYCAR commentary team Kevin Lee (move by move), Townsend Bell (Analyst) and James Hinchcliffe (Analyst) will commentate on this weekend’s races. Dillon Welch And Georgia Henneberry will report from the pit lane on Saturday and Sunday.

PRO MOTOCROSS: NATIONAL IRONMAN FINAL

The final race of the 2024 Pro Motocross Championship regular season culminates in the Ironman National Finals this Saturday at Ironman Raceway in Crawfordsville, Indiana, at 1:00 p.m. ET exclusively on Peacock.

Chase Sexton (454 points), winner of five consecutive races, leads the 450 class point standings and is on the verge of his first 450 class regular season motocross title. Hunter Lawrence (-28) his only fight for the crown. In the 250cc class Haiden Deegan (445 points) has already secured his first championship title in the regular season of the 250 motocross class.
